Episyron is a genus of wasps in the family Pompilidae which prey on spiders. Nine species are found in Europe.[2]
Features
[edit]Episyron wasps are medium to large in size. The head and thorax have long, dark clustered hair with spotted abdomens.
Habits
[edit]These wasps occur in open sandy habitats where the females can burrow easily to create nests. They prey on spiders of the families Araneidae, Lycosidae and Tetragnathidae.[2]
